The master's degree Plant Biodiversity and Management of Tropical Ecosystems (BioGET)
Its objective is to train students in the knowledge and management of tropical ecosystems, particularly in their plant component. Its ambition is to train scientists and experts in plant biodiversity in tropical regions.
